Duties and Responsibilities:
The Field Experience Office Assistant supports the Director of Field Experience in organizing placements for more than 300 Education students. Building positive relationships with school and division representatives is crucial to this role. This position is responsible for developing and managing spreadsheets for field placements; facilitating student teaching placements under the Director’s guidance; and administering contracts for field experience supervisors. Additional tasks in this position involve assisting in event planning and coordination (such as orientations, professional development sessions, and career fairs); serving as the main point of contact for students at the front counter by offering guidance, resources, and program support; maintaining student records; and overseeing budgets and other relevant duties as assigned.
